For example - if you are for Universal Health Care I'd like you to answer these following questions:
- What will be the actual changes wanted to be made?
- What will be the necessary requirements to get these changes in place
- Who will be impacted by the requirements (what groups- persons)
- What are the potential long term impacts on those specific groups
- What are the expected benefits?
- How can the benefits be achieved
- What are the potential pit falls
- Do the pitfalls balance the benefits
- Is the program(s) sustainable longterm
Once you answer these questions, sit back and THEN decide if you think "Universal Government Controlled" health care is the right answer for this country. When I do this, nothing Clinton or Obama have put forth seem to actually benefit anyone except government
If you just answer the positives and ignore the negatives - you are only thinking emotionally and selfishly. It's it not just about YOU. The entire country is affected by your actions.
